Ludhiana: Over 30 wrestlers from Punjab and Haryana took part in the 26th edition of the Open Wrestling Competition organised by the Peer Baba Mehar Shah Sports Club at the PUDA ground opposite Civil Hospital here on Saturday. In the three bouts held for cash prizes, Chhinda of Narangwal overpowered Kaku from Tarn Taran; Dimpy of Ludhiana got the better of Mohit from Banga and in the third one, Rajesh of Ludhiana stadium and Kirti of Shivpuri Akhara remained unresolved and they shared the prize money. In the competition organised for amateurs, Savi of Narangwal beat Teeka of Noorwala Road; Ashu of Jalandhar beat Abhishek of Shivpuri Akhara; Navdeep of Ludhiana stadium beat Navdeep of Noorwala Road; Kaku Tarn Taran beat Abhinav of Ludhiana stadium and Bawa of Narangwal beat Rohit of Panipat. Earlier, MLA Surinder Dawar inaugurated the competition. Ramesh Kandiarey and Subhash Sondhi, president and vice-president, respectively, of the organising club, Yash Pal, councillor, Municipal Corporation, Ludhiana, Luv Dravid and Rajender Hans gave away prizes to the participants. Bishan Singh, Vicky Bhatti, Sardul Singh and Rahul Kashyap were among other office-bearers present on the occasion.— OC
